  1. # Roaming tests
  2. # Copyright (c) 2013, Jouni Malinen <j@w1.fi>
  3. #
  4. # This software may be distributed under the terms of the BSD license.
  5. # See README for more details.
  6. import time
  7. import logging
  8. logger = logging.getLogger()
  9. import hwsim_utils
  10. import hostapd
  11. def test_ap_roam_open(dev, apdev):
  12. """Roam between two open APs"""
  13. hapd0 = hostapd.add_ap(apdev[0], { "ssid": "test-open" })
  14. dev[0].connect("test-open", key_mgmt="NONE")
  15. hwsim_utils.test_connectivity(dev[0], hapd0)
  16. hapd1 = hostapd.add_ap(apdev[1], { "ssid": "test-open" })
  17. dev[0].scan(type="ONLY")
  18. dev[0].roam(apdev[1]['bssid'])
  19. hwsim_utils.test_connectivity(dev[0], hapd1)
  20. dev[0].roam(apdev[0]['bssid'])
  21. hwsim_utils.test_connectivity(dev[0], hapd0)
  22. def test_ap_roam_open_failed(dev, apdev):
  23. """Roam failure due to rejected authentication"""
  24. hapd0 = hostapd.add_ap(apdev[0], { "ssid": "test-open" })
  25. dev[0].connect("test-open", key_mgmt="NONE", scan_freq="2412")
  26. hwsim_utils.test_connectivity(dev[0], hapd0)
  27. params = { "ssid": "test-open", "max_num_sta" : "0" }
  28. hapd1 = hostapd.add_ap(apdev[1], params)
  29. bssid = hapd1.own_addr()
  30. dev[0].scan_for_bss(bssid, freq=2412)
  31. dev[0].dump_monitor()
  32. if "OK" not in dev[0].request("ROAM " + bssid):
  33. raise Exception("ROAM failed")
  34. ev = dev[0].wait_event(["CTRL-EVENT-AUTH-REJECT"], 1)
  35. if not ev:
  36. raise Exception("CTRL-EVENT-AUTH-REJECT was not seen")
  37. dev[0].wait_connected(timeout=5)
  38. hwsim_utils.test_connectivity(dev[0], hapd0)
  39. def test_ap_roam_wpa2_psk(dev, apdev):
  40. """Roam between two WPA2-PSK APs"""
  41. params = hostapd.wpa2_params(ssid="test-wpa2-psk", passphrase="12345678")
  42. hapd0 = hostapd.add_ap(apdev[0], params)
  43. dev[0].connect("test-wpa2-psk", psk="12345678")
  44. hwsim_utils.test_connectivity(dev[0], hapd0)
  45. hapd1 = hostapd.add_ap(apdev[1], params)
  46. dev[0].scan(type="ONLY")
  47. dev[0].roam(apdev[1]['bssid'])
  48. hwsim_utils.test_connectivity(dev[0], hapd1)
  49. dev[0].roam(apdev[0]['bssid'])
  50. hwsim_utils.test_connectivity(dev[0], hapd0)
  51. def test_ap_roam_wpa2_psk_failed(dev, apdev, params):
  52. """Roam failure with WPA2-PSK AP due to wrong passphrase"""
  53. params = hostapd.wpa2_params(ssid="test-wpa2-psk", passphrase="12345678")
  54. hapd0 = hostapd.add_ap(apdev[0], params)
  55. id = dev[0].connect("test-wpa2-psk", psk="12345678", scan_freq="2412")
  56. hwsim_utils.test_connectivity(dev[0], hapd0)
  57. params['wpa_passphrase'] = "22345678"
  58. hapd1 = hostapd.add_ap(apdev[1], params)
  59. bssid = hapd1.own_addr()
  60. dev[0].scan_for_bss(bssid, freq=2412)
  61. dev[0].dump_monitor()
  62. if "OK" not in dev[0].request("ROAM " + bssid):
  63. raise Exception("ROAM failed")
  64. ev = dev[0].wait_event(["CTRL-EVENT-SSID-TEMP-DISABLED",
  65. "CTRL-EVENT-CONNECTED"], 5)
  66. if "CTRL-EVENT-CONNECTED" in ev:
  67. raise Exception("Got unexpected CTRL-EVENT-CONNECTED")
  68. if "CTRL-EVENT-SSID-TEMP-DISABLED" not in ev:
  69. raise Exception("CTRL-EVENT-SSID-TEMP-DISABLED not seen")
  70. if "OK" not in dev[0].request("SELECT_NETWORK id=" + str(id)):
  71. raise Exception("SELECT_NETWORK failed")
  72. ev = dev[0].wait_event(["CTRL-EVENT-SSID-REENABLED"], 3)
  73. if not ev:
  74. raise Exception("CTRL-EVENT-SSID-REENABLED not seen");
  75. dev[0].wait_connected(timeout=5)
  76. hwsim_utils.test_connectivity(dev[0], hapd0)
  77. def test_ap_reassociation_to_same_bss(dev, apdev):
  78. """Reassociate to the same BSS"""
  79. hapd = hostapd.add_ap(apdev[0], { "ssid": "test-open" })
  80. dev[0].connect("test-open", key_mgmt="NONE")
  81. dev[0].request("REASSOCIATE")
  82. dev[0].wait_connected(timeout=10, error="Reassociation timed out")
  83. hwsim_utils.test_connectivity(dev[0], hapd)
  84. dev[0].request("REATTACH")
  85. dev[0].wait_connected(timeout=10, error="Reattach timed out")
  86. hwsim_utils.test_connectivity(dev[0], hapd)
  87. # Wait for previous scan results to expire to trigger new scan
  88. time.sleep(5)
  89. dev[0].request("REATTACH")
  90. dev[0].wait_connected(timeout=10, error="Reattach timed out")
  91. hwsim_utils.test_connectivity(dev[0], hapd)
  92. def test_ap_roam_set_bssid(dev, apdev):
  93. """Roam control"""
  94. hostapd.add_ap(apdev[0], { "ssid": "test-open" })
  95. hostapd.add_ap(apdev[1], { "ssid": "test-open" })
  96. id = dev[0].connect("test-open", key_mgmt="NONE", bssid=apdev[1]['bssid'],
  97. scan_freq="2412")
  98. if dev[0].get_status_field('bssid') != apdev[1]['bssid']:
  99. raise Exception("Unexpected BSS")
  100. # for now, these are just verifying that the code path to indicate
  101. # within-ESS roaming changes can be executed; the actual results of those
  102. # operations are not currently verified (that would require a test driver
  103. # that does BSS selection)
  104. dev[0].set_network(id, "bssid", "")
  105. dev[0].set_network(id, "bssid", apdev[0]['bssid'])
  106. dev[0].set_network(id, "bssid", apdev[1]['bssid'])
  107. def test_ap_roam_wpa2_psk_race(dev, apdev):
  108. """Roam between two WPA2-PSK APs and try to hit a disconnection race"""
  109. params = hostapd.wpa2_params(ssid="test-wpa2-psk", passphrase="12345678")
  110. hapd0 = hostapd.add_ap(apdev[0], params)
  111. dev[0].connect("test-wpa2-psk", psk="12345678", scan_freq="2412")
  112. hwsim_utils.test_connectivity(dev[0], hapd0)
  113. params['channel'] = '2'
  114. hapd1 = hostapd.add_ap(apdev[1], params)
  115. dev[0].scan_for_bss(apdev[1]['bssid'], freq=2417)
  116. dev[0].roam(apdev[1]['bssid'])
  117. hwsim_utils.test_connectivity(dev[0], hapd1)
  118. dev[0].roam(apdev[0]['bssid'])
  119. hwsim_utils.test_connectivity(dev[0], hapd0)
  120. # Wait at least two seconds to trigger the previous issue with the
  121. # disconnection callback.
  122. for i in range(3):
  123. time.sleep(0.8)
  124. hwsim_utils.test_connectivity(dev[0], hapd0)
